Pelling : Where Clouds Touch The Peaks Of The Himalayas

🏔️ Pelling (Sikkim)

🌿 Overview

Pelling stands as one of the most enchanting and spiritually significant destinations in the northeastern Himalayan region of India, representing far more than a hill station on a map. Situated on the western slopes of Sikkim, at an elevation of approximately 2,200 meters, Pelling is recognized as a place of profound natural beauty and Buddhist spiritual heritage. The destination draws pilgrims, trekkers, and travelers from across the world, offering a landscape defined by ancient monasteries, panoramic mountain vistas, and an atmosphere of serene mountain contemplation rarely matched elsewhere.

What distinguishes Pelling from other heritage destinations in the Himalayan region is not merely its spiritual significance, but the unique combination of living Buddhist monastic tradition, spectacular natural scenery, and proximity to the majestic Kanchenjunga mountain embedded in this compact hillside town. The area is anchored by the Pemayangtse Monastery, one of Sikkim's oldest and most revered Buddhist centers, and surrounded by other sacred sites including the Sangacholing Monastery and the Kardo Ri Monastery. This layered character elevates Pelling beyond a simple hill station into a destination of genuine cultural, spiritual, and natural discovery.

🏛️ Key Highlights Within the Area

Among the sacred landmarks, the Pemayangtse Monastery stands out as the most iconic and spiritually significant feature of Pelling. Founded in the 17th century, this magnificent complex comprises the main prayer hall, ornate wooden structures, intricate religious paintings, and several smaller shrines, all steeped in religious significance and offering a setting framed by prayer flags, chanting monks, and centuries-old artistic traditions. The interplay of golden roof ornaments and ancient wooden carvings creates a visual experience that shifts beautifully with the changing light of dawn and dusk.

The panoramic view of Kanchenjunga and the surrounding mountain range, particularly visible during clear mornings, represents another defining highlight. The sight of this sacred peak from designated viewpoints like Pelling View Point offers a serene and contemplative space, providing a compelling combination of natural sublimity and spiritual resonance in a single vantage point.

🌸 Best Time to Visit

The most favorable period to visit Pelling is from March to May, when temperatures are pleasant, the skies tend to be clear, and the hillsides burst with blooming rhododendrons and magnolias.

🚗 Connectivity

Pelling is conveniently accessible from several major urban centers in northeastern India and the broader region. Siliguri, located approximately 120 kilometers away in West Bengal, is the nearest major city and serves as the most practical base for reaching Pelling by road.
